By Dara Lind, Vox

When the child-migrant crisis was in the headlines over the summer, Ted Cruz tried to make the case that President Obama was to blame — most specifically, his Deferred Action for Childhood Arrivals program, which Cruz called “executive amnesty.”

Now, the number of children entering the US has plummeted — stunningly. The reasons why are complex, and worth looking into.

One thing that’s clear, though, is that DACA’s still on the books. Cruz’ narrative is imperiled.

In fact, if the president’s promises of executive action really were the most important factor in the migrant crisis, Cruz might want to use this chart the next time he’s on the Senate floor:

UAC apprehensions chart, Ted Cruz edition

After all, it’s the perfect companion to the chart Cruz used to blame Obama for the crisis back in July.
